## ProfileVault Environments

ProfileVault shards the user-profile store across four partitions in staging and sixteen in production. Shard assignment is hash-based on account ID, so rebalancing only happens during planned resharding windows. If you're on call and see hot-shard alerts, check the partition map before touching anything — most pages resolve to a single overloaded shard. The active shard configuration for production is as follows.

settings of hahag-taweg:
[jorius]
team = gilox
access_code = ac_b64218
host = jorius.zarqelstack.example
port = 8080
owner = quenath.briax
peer = eliix.halixcloud.corp

// Flush interval for the Lanternmark metrics sidecar.
// Lower values overwhelm the aggregation endpoint; higher
// values risk losing a full window on sidecar restart.
// 15s was chosen after the Dovebridge load tests — do not
// change without rerunning the soak suite. Reviewer: confirm
// this matches the value baked into the deploy manifest.
// The sidecar build this was validated against is noted below.

build token for tawip-yageg: htk9_92ac43d42

**Compression tradeoffs for Lanternwire sockets**

Lanternwire supports per-message deflate on its websocket layer, but context takeover costs roughly 300KB of memory per connection, which matters at our fan-out scale. We disable takeover for broadcast channels and enable it only for chat-style sessions where payloads repeat heavily. CPU cost is the other axis: higher compression levels help bandwidth on mobile but hurt tail latency on the Quillford relay tier. The current defaults balance both concerns.

tuning table, kajog-kawef:
PRIORITIES = {
    "kelox": 870,
    "kasix": 89,
    "eliax": 988,
}

## Tax-Rate Lookup Cache

The Copperdale service caches jurisdiction tax rates in an in-memory LRU with a 24-hour TTL, refreshed nightly from the Marleyfort rates feed. Never bypass the cache in request paths; stale entries are acceptable per finance policy. Manual invalidation requires a change ticket. For cache questions or invalidation requests, write to the address below.

escalation mailbox, hafop-fahop: ralix_oliael@qirvanlabs.internal